architecture पर टैग किए गए जवाब

सॉफ्टवेयर सिस्टम का उच्च-स्तरीय डिजाइन और विवरण। वास्तुशिल्प डिजाइन "ब्लैक बॉक्स" घटकों की बातचीत पर ध्यान केंद्रित करने के लिए कार्यान्वयन, एल्गोरिदम और डेटा प्रतिनिधित्व के विवरण को दूर करता है।

3
एक ही कार्यक्षमता की पेशकश करने वाले दो घटक, विभिन्न निर्भरताओं द्वारा आवश्यक
मैं ORM परत के रूप में Zend फ्रेमवर्क 1 और Doctrine2 का उपयोग करके PHP में एक एप्लिकेशन बना रहा हूं। सब ठीक चल रहा है। अब, मैं नोटिस करने के लिए हुआ कि ZF1 और Doctrine2 दोनों साथ आते हैं, और अपने स्वयं के कैशिंग कार्यान्वयन पर भरोसा करते …

4
वंशानुक्रम से क्यों बचा जाना चाहिए?
मुझे याद है कि VB4 सीखना और एक फॉर्म पर एक बटन खींचना, उस बटन पर डबल-क्लिक करना और उस ईवेंट हैंडलर में टाइपिंग कोड जो मैं अभी-अभी जादुई रूप से धन्य था। QBASIC I से "VB" में "V" के साथ रोमांचित था, दृश्य डिजाइनर सचमुच कटा हुआ ब्रेड के …

3
डीडीडी में प्रस्तुति वी.एस. एप्लीकेशन लेयर
मुझे डोमेन ड्रिवेन डिज़ाइन में प्रस्तुति और एप्लिकेशन परत के बीच एक स्पष्ट रेखा खींचने में समस्या है। नियंत्रक, दृश्य, लेआउट, जावास्क्रिप्ट और CSS फाइलें कहां जानी चाहिए? यह अनुप्रयोग या प्रस्तुति परत में है? और अगर वे सभी एक ही परत में एक साथ जाते हैं, तो दूसरे में …

7
वहाँ स्प्रिंट के बीच एक काम कर निर्माण के अलावा अन्य चुस्त प्रथाओं के फायदे हैं?
मुझे हाल ही में सॉफ्टवेयर विकास में चुस्त प्रथाओं में दिलचस्पी हो गई और मैंने तब से बहुत सारे लेखों को देखा है कि ये अभ्यास समग्र लागतों को कम करने की अनुमति देते हैं। इसके पीछे का तर्क आमतौर पर इस तरह से चलता है: यदि आपकी आवश्यकताएं बदल …

2
.NET (विजुअल स्टूडियो) में, आप एक नया असेंबली कब बनाते हैं?
मैं सिल्वरलाइट एप्लिकेशन पर काम कर रहा हूं। मैंने इसे कई विधानसभाओं में विभाजित किया है: डोमेन भंडार (स्टर्लिंग डेटाबेस के लिए सब कुछ के साथ) यूआई ... यह मैंने इसे कैसे सीखा है, लेकिन मैंने सोचा। यदि आप जानते हैं कि DLL का पुन: उपयोग नहीं होने जा रहा …

8
अल्ट्रा-फास्ट डेटाबेस में एक अरब पंक्तियों को स्कैन करना
पृष्ठभूमि एक स्थानीय डेटाबेस में लगभग 1.3 बिलियन अद्वितीय पंक्तियाँ होती हैं। प्रत्येक पंक्ति अप्रत्यक्ष रूप से एक विशिष्ट अक्षांश और देशांतर (स्थान) से जुड़ी होती है। प्रत्येक पंक्ति में एक तारीख मोहर होती है। उदाहरण समस्या इस प्रकार है: उपयोगकर्ता एक प्रारंभिक / समाप्ति तिथि और मूल्यों की एक …

2
हल्के वास्तुकला मूल्यांकन करने के लिए एक अच्छी विधि क्या है?
मैं आर्किटेक्चर मूल्यांकन विधियों जैसे तकनीकी आर्किटेक्चर ट्रेडऑफ़ एनालिसिस विधि (एटीएएम) और अधिक व्यापार-उन्मुख लागत लाभ विश्लेषण विधि (सीबीएएम) से परिचित हूं । हालांकि, ये विधियां काफी बड़े पैमाने पर हैं: वे कई मंथन सत्रों, प्रस्तुतियों, ट्रेडऑफ का वर्णन करने वाले परिदृश्यों के एक मेजबान के विकास आदि को निर्धारित …

1
क्या वर्तमान साक्ष्य कैनोनिकल डेटा मॉडल पर प्रासंगिक होने को अपनाने का समर्थन करते हैं?
"विहित" विचार सॉफ्टवेयर में व्याप्त है; Canonical Model , Canonical Schema , Canonical Data Model इत्यादि जैसे पैटर्न विकास में बार-बार आते हैं। कई डेवलपर्स की तरह, मैंने अक्सर, अनजाने में, पारंपरिक ज्ञान का पालन किया है, जिसे आपको एक कैनोनिकल मॉडल की आवश्यकता होती है, अन्यथा आपको मैपर और …

2
क्लाइंट पक्ष में सभी UI तर्क चल रहे हैं?
हमारी टीम मूल रूप से जावास्क्रिप्ट में न्यूनतम विशेषज्ञता वाले ज्यादातर सर्वर साइड डेवलपर्स शामिल थी। ASP.NET में हम MVC में नियंत्रकों के माध्यम से या हाल ही में MVC में बहुत सारे यूआई लॉजिक लिखते थे। थोड़ी देर पहले 2 उच्च स्तरीय क्लाइंट साइड डेवलपर्स हमारी टीम में शामिल …

2
यूआई स्वचालन पैटर्न और डेस्कटॉप अनुप्रयोगों के लिए सबसे अच्छा अभ्यास
पृष्ठभूमि मैं वर्तमान में एमएस ऑफिस के लिए एक प्लगइन के लिए कुछ परीक्षण स्वचालित कर रहा हूं। हम वीएस 2010 में कोडेड यूआई परीक्षण बना रहे हैं। मुझे लगता है कि मैं " कोडेड यूआई टेस्ट बिल्डर " टूल का उपयोग कर सकता हूं , लेकिन यह वास्तव में …
ह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.